TikTok Tests Footnotes to Combat Misinformation

TikTok Introduces Footnotes to Enhance Context

TikTok is currently testing a new feature called “Footnotes” that aims to provide users with additional context for videos that may be misleading. This feature is being rolled out in the United States, where TikTok boasts around 170 million users. Footnotes will allow the community to contribute relevant information, helping viewers better understand video content.

Unlike similar tools on other platforms, TikTok plans to maintain its own fact-checking efforts alongside Footnotes. Adam Presser, head of operations, explained that this feature will complement existing measures such as content labels and search banners, offering a more comprehensive approach to verifying information.

How Footnotes Will Work on TikTok

Adult US users who have been active on TikTok for at least six months and have maintained good standing with community guidelines can apply to become Footnotes contributors. These contributors can add context to videos and also rate the Footnotes submitted by others. Footnotes that receive positive feedback will become visible to all users, who can then vote on their usefulness.

“Whether the content discusses a complex STEM-related concept, shares statistics that could misrepresent a topic, or updates about an ongoing event, there may be additional context that could help others better understand it,” Presser noted. “That’s why we’re building Footnotes.” This community-driven approach aims to enhance the reliability of content by providing more background and authoritative sources.

Footnotes and TikTok’s Ongoing Misinformation Efforts

Footnotes will enhance TikTok’s existing integrity tools, such as labels for unverifiable content and partnerships with fact-checking organizations to assess accuracy. This new feature seeks to harness the collective knowledge of users to combat misinformation more effectively.

Meanwhile, other social media companies have moved away from traditional fact-checking programs. For example, some platforms have replaced third-party fact-checking with crowd-sourced context tools similar to Footnotes. However, the effectiveness of such tools remains debated, especially amid concerns about censorship and bias from various political groups.

Context Amid TikTok’s US Regulatory Challenges

The introduction of Footnotes comes as TikTok’s parent company faces pressure from US regulators to address data security concerns. There are ongoing talks about a potential sale or restructuring of the app to avoid a ban in the US. Despite reports of an agreement, recent trade tensions have complicated the process.

While these discussions continue, TikTok is focusing on improving user trust through features like Footnotes. By enabling users to add informative context, the platform hopes to foster a more informed community and reduce the spread of false information.
